    There are two ways to ask the first question. What is the the time now? What time is it now? In the second sentence, although the meaning of the adverb, “before” is similar to 以前, the use in English is not the same as that in Chinese. We would not use it in this sentence. Rather we would use the adjective “ago” which means “gone by” or “past” and follows a noun. What time was it 30 minutes ago? Likewise: And what about 2 hours ago?
